well i was in,

after i regerstered i started to look at the info packet. and this year there is a new rule, i understand the rule but won't be able to comply by the time the event comes around.

* Harnesses and Seats – Restraints and seating must be the same for driver and passenger. A driver cannot use a harness unless there is an equal one for the passenger. Harnesses must pass through the seat and not around it and be installed as per manufacturers guidelines. Installation accuracy is the responsibility of the student.

i running five point harness with my stock mid-back seats. but the Roc said this is an absolut rule. which i understand. this upcoming winter project is to put in a full roll cage with race seats but i can't get it done before august.

i'll just have to wait till next year, i hope this won't be a problem for the autocross next weekend at NCM.
